Aggregate supply slopes up because when the price level for outputs increases, while the price level of inputs remains fixed, the opportunity for additional profits encourages more production. The aggregate supply curve is nearhorizontal on the left and nearvertical on the right. plants MAINELEC Refers to plants which are designed to produce electricity only. If one or more units of the plant is a CHP unit (and the inputs and outputs cannot be distinguished on a unit basis) then the whole plant is designated as a CHP plant. · USDA's Economic Research Service (ERS) has constructed accounts for the farm sector consistent with a gross output model of production (see Shumway et al. 2017, Ball et al. 2016). Output is defined as gross production leaving the farm, as opposed to real value added. Inputs are not limited to labor and capital but include intermediate inputs as well. .

Figure 1. Shifts in Aggregate Demand. (a) An increase in consumer confidence or business confidence can shift AD to the right, from AD 0 to AD AD shifts to the right, the new equilibrium (E 1) will have a higher quantity of output and also a higher price level compared with the original equilibrium (E 0).In this example, the new equilibrium (E 1) is also closer to potential GDP.
